Weight Capacity Considerations
Choosing the right weight capacity for a two-person inflatable kayak is vital because it directly impacts your safety and enjoyment on the water. Most kayaks have a weight capacity ranging from 400 to 550 pounds, which includes both paddlers and your gear. If you exceed this limit, you might face stability issues, an increased risk of capsizing, and diminished performance. It’s important to take into account your combined weight along with any additional equipment like coolers or fishing gear. Remember, even weight distribution is key for maneuverability and handling. If you’re planning family outings or anticipate extra gear, opting for a higher weight capacity kayak can provide added comfort and versatility, ensuring a better experience on the water.
Construction Material Durability
After considering weight capacity, the next important aspect to evaluate is the construction material of an inflatable kayak. I’ve found that materials like PVC or heavy-duty vinyl offer excellent resistance to punctures and abrasions, ensuring your kayak lasts through many adventures. Kayaks with a 3-ply laminate construction greatly enhance durability and structural strength, allowing them to withstand impacts and sun exposure without degrading. Reinforced stitching and high-pressure drop stitch designs provide rigidity and stability, making them suitable for various water conditions. Plus, anti-slip floors boost safety and comfort while you navigate rough waters. Ultimately, you’ll want a kayak that not only supports two adults and gear but also stands up to the rigors of your outings.

Stability and Maneuverability
While exploring inflatable kayaks for two, I always pay close attention to stability and maneuverability. A wide beam design notably enhances stability, allowing for better balance in various water conditions. I find that kayaks with high-pressure inflation capabilities offer improved rigidity, which helps maintain control as I paddle. Removable skegs are another feature I love—they enhance directional movement, making navigation in calm and choppy waters much easier. Additionally, kayaks with high-buoyancy side chambers provide extra stability, reducing the risk of tipping. Finally, a lightweight design facilitates easy handling and quick direction adjustments, ensuring a smoother paddling experience. When considering a kayak, these factors are essential in ensuring safety and enjoyment on the water.

How Do You Repair a Punctured Inflatable Kayak?
Ah, the art of mending! When I punctured my inflatable kayak, I quickly cleaned the area around the hole and let it dry. I then applied a patch with adhesive, ensuring it covered the puncture fully. After pressing it down firmly, I waited for the adhesive to cure, usually a few hours. Finally, I tested for leaks by inflating it and checking the patch. It’s a simple process that saves the day!
